.elementor-44 .elementor-element.elementor-element-185d3c4{--display:flex;--flex-direction:row;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:100%;--container-widget-flex-grow:1;--container-widget-align-self:stretch;--justify-content:space-between;--align-items:center;--background-transition:0.3s;--padding-top:01%;--padding-bottom:1%;--padding-left:04%;--padding-right:04%;}.elementor-44 .elementor-element.elementor-element-185d3c4:not(.elementor-motion-effects-element-type-background), .elementor-44 .elementor-element.elementor-element-185d3c4 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:var( --e-global-color-text );}.elementor-44 .elementor-element.elementor-element-185d3c4, .elementor-44 .elementor-element.elementor-element-185d3c4::before{--border-transition:0.3s;}.elementor-44 .elementor-element.elementor-element-7a4ae7c{text-align:left;width:var( --container-widget-width, 191px );max-width:191px;--container-widget-width:191px;--container-widget-flex-grow:0;}@media(min-width:768px){.elementor-44 .elementor-element.elementor-element-185d3c4{--content-width:1668px;}}@media(max-width:1024px){.elementor-44 .elementor-element.elementor-element-185d3c4{--padding-top:02%;--padding-bottom:2%;--padding-left:5%;--padding-right:5%;}.elementor-44 .elementor-element.elementor-element-7a4ae7c{--container-widget-width:120px;--container-widget-flex-grow:0;width:var( --container-widget-width, 120px );max-width:120px;}}@media(max-width:767px){.elementor-44 .elementor-element.elementor-element-185d3c4{--padding-top:4%;--padding-bottom:4%;--padding-left:6%;--padding-right:06%;}.elementor-44 .elementor-element.elementor-element-7a4ae7c{--container-widget-width:110px;--container-widget-flex-grow:0;width:var( --container-widget-width, 110px );max-width:110px;}}/* Start custom CSS for theme-site-logo, class: .elementor-element-7a4ae7c */@media (min-width:1025px){
    #logo img {
max-width: 100%;
height: auto;
transition: all 0.3s ease;
}

.elementor-sticky--effects #logo img {
max-width: 70%;
height: auto;
}}/* End custom CSS */
/* Start custom CSS for container, class: .elementor-element-185d3c4 */.elementor-44 .elementor-element.elementor-element-185d3c4.elementor-sticky--effects{
background-color: white !important;
box-shadow: 8px 6px 41px 0px rgba(0, 0, 0, 0.12);
}

.elementor-44 .elementor-element.elementor-element-185d3c4{
transition: background-color 0.3s ease !important;

}
.elementor-44 .elementor-element.elementor-element-185d3c4.elementor-sticky--effects >.elementor-container{
min-height: 70%;
}

.elementor-44 .elementor-element.elementor-element-185d3c4 > .elementor-container{
transition: min-height 0.3s ease !important;
}
.elementor-44 .elementor-element.elementor-element-185d3c4.elementor-sticky--effects  .tb-nav .menu > li > a {
    color: var(--e-global-color-text);
}
.elementor-44 .elementor-element.elementor-element-185d3c4.elementor-sticky--effects  .tb-nav .menu > li > a:hover {
    color: var(--e-global-color-primary);
}
.elementor-44 .elementor-element.elementor-element-185d3c4.elementor-sticky--effects .tb-nav .current_page_item:after, .elementor-44 .elementor-element.elementor-element-185d3c4.elementor-sticky--effects .tb-nav__toggle-bar {
    background-color: var(--e-global-color-text);
}
@media (max-width:1024px){
.tb-nav .menu > li > a {
    color: var(--e-global-color-text);
}  
}/* End custom CSS */